The Outstanding Service Award honors individuals whose sustained dedication and leadership have made a lasting impact on mathematics education and the FTYCMA community. Recipients exemplify excellence not only through effective pedagogy and strong support for student success, but also through their advocacy for mathematics education and their commitment to advancing the profession.

Nominations for the Outstanding Services award are accepted in December of even years. The winner of the Teaching Excellence Award is announced at the Annual Business meeting of odd years and celebrated at the Fall Retreat in odd years.
